Motinagar - Kusmi(Samri), Balrampur-Ramanujganj

Motinagar is a village situated in the Kusmi(Samri) tehsil of Balrampur-Ramanujganj district, Chhattisgarh. It is located approximately 13 km from Kusmi and around 95 km from Ambikapur. Motinagar village is a designated Gram Panchayat.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Motinagar is 432361. The village covers a total geographical area of 325.306 hectares and falls under the 497224 pincode. Kusmi is the nearest town, located about 13 km away.

Motinagar village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head.

Population of Motinagar

As per Census 2011, Motinagar village has a total population of 621 people, consisting of 336 males and 285 females. The village has 149 households and a sex ratio of 848 females per 1,000 males. There are 77 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 323 literate and 298 illiterate residents. Additionally, 447 people belong to Scheduled Tribe (ST) communities.

Transport and Connectivity of Motinagar

Motinagar is connected by an all-weather road, and public transport is mainly available through shared auto-rickshaws. The nearest railway station is Barwadih Jn, while the nearest airport is Birsa Munda Airport, situated at an approximate aerial distance of 123.2 km.

The road distance from Kusmi to Motinagar is about 13 km, with a usual travel time of around 30-60 minutes. Similarly, the road distance from Ambikapur to Motinagar is about 95 km, with the usual travel time around ~2.7 hours. Actual travel time may vary depending on road conditions and mode of transport.
